MAYBE wrestling isnt the problem... maybe its football or BASKETBALL... are u familiar with the Kevin Ross story. I will give u a short summary. Kevin Ross was a really tall kids who grew up in the early 70's. of course if u are dunkin the ball in the 6th grade you might make a good basketball player. Kevin attended the same Junior High that I work at now then later on attend Wyandotte High School. He had a very successful high school basketball winning a state title. He was recruited to Creighton University and played for 3 years. He was injured most of the time and after an injury in his senior year of college not only was he cut off the team but his scholarship was dropped. Kevin eventually sued the school not because they used him for basketball but because after 6 years of elementary education, 2 years of junior high school, 4 years of high school, and 3.5 years of college... KEVIN ROSS COULDNT READ!!!
